We are recruiting a full time Kennel Assistant to join an established team within a Kennels and Cattery based in Copdock, nr Ipswich. Easy access from both Ipswich and Colchester via the A12.

This position would suit an energetic and friendly person who has a passion for working with animals, ensuring the highest standard of animal welfare. The role will involve working within a busy team: walking, cleaning, feeding and providing a high level of care for our dogs and cats.

Requirements

  • Must have a genuine passion for dogs and cats
  • Experience in animal care / animal management is preferred (not essential)
  • Being familiar with handling dogs of different sizes and temperaments
  • Physically capable
  • Team player - able to work effectively in a small team
  • Strong work ethic - reliable and punctual
  • Ability to work independently and follow instructions where needed
  • Willingness to roll sleeves up and get hands dirty!

Hours of work: split shifts Monday to Sunday (8am - 11am & 3pm - 6pm).

Salary dependent on experience. Car driver with own transport essential.
